Transaction 9e834854e6588aeeed1db76f5569a1d265d977123e4c5ca53c8e22647fa210fc

23 Input
1 Outputs
  • 9e834854e6588aeeed1db76f5569a1d265d977123e4c5ca53c8e22647fa210fc:0
  • value  2440861
    address  37aKvKbH8TtMCdGJ114H7jwjc1WaCsu4pa